HuskerRob Posted February 11, 2010 Share Posted February 11, 2010 I agree with almost everybody else, being ranked fifth is much too high. It goes without saying that we lose some serious talent on the defensive side of the ball, and our offense is nowhere near top 5 material. I'm not saying that we don't have the potential to be ranked this high, as I expect the offense to be much improved. Don't sleep on Cody Green, it wouldn't surprise me to see him have a terrific spring ball, and put some serious pressure on Zac Lee. Our offense is transforming into one that demands a mobile quarterback, and Lee just doesn't cut it in that department. I would also really like to see Tray Robinson establish himself as a back who deserves carries. I'm a big fan of having three capable backs that get carries, and I know Watson believes in that philosophy too. It should be a very intriguing matchup to see who grabs hold of the third running back between Tray Robinson and Braylon Heard. No Kool-Aid, just my honest football opinion...I will consider the 2010 season a disappointment if we fail to win the Big Twelve Championship. Quote Link to comment
